summaryrefslogtreecommitdiff
path: root/lto-plugin/configure.ac
blob: 15bc1a6b53bc058e7c5a07cfd608a64b9f697e2e (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
AC_PREREQ(2.64)
AC_INIT([LTO plugin for ld], 0.1,,[lto-plugin])
AC_CANONICAL_SYSTEM
GCC_TOPLEV_SUBDIRS
AM_INIT_AUTOMAKE([foreign no-dist])
AM_MAINTAINER_MODE
AC_PROG_CC
AC_SYS_LARGEFILE
AM_PROG_LIBTOOL
AC_SUBST(target_noncanonical)
# Trying to get this information from gcc's config is tricky.
case $target in
  x86_64*-mingw*)
    AC_DEFINE([SYM_STYLE], [ss_none], [Default symbol style])
    ;;
  *-cygwin* | i?86*-mingw* )
    AC_DEFINE([SYM_STYLE], [ss_win32], [Default symbol style])
    ;;
  *)
    AC_DEFINE([SYM_STYLE], [ss_none], [Default symbol style])
    ;;
esac
AC_TYPE_INT64_T
AC_TYPE_UINT64_T
AC_CONFIG_FILES(Makefile)
AC_CONFIG_HEADERS(config.h)
AC_OUTPUT